This will become a concern – Danny Mills predicts choppy waters ahead for Liverpool

Liverpool have made an outstanding start to the season in the Premier League and the Champions League but there are issues that the club hierarchy need to sort out in the coming months to avoid a disruptive effect on the team.

The Merseyside giants are sitting at the summit of the Premier League table after seven league games with Arne Slot making an instant impact as their new manager.

Liverpool have emerged as real title contenders under the new manager in the early part of the season despite tougher tests lying ahead after the international break.

However, Liverpool fans are aware that optimism could soon make way for pessimism if the Liverpool board do not act soon enough and sort out the futures of Mohamed Salah, Virgil van Dijk and Trent Alexander-Arnold.

The three stalwarts of Liverpool’s recent success are out of contract at the end of the season and could leave on a free transfer at the end of the season.

Danny Mills insists that the contract situations of the Liverpool trio could derail their season

As things stand, all three players will be free to discuss a pre-contract with clubs outside England once the transfer window opens again in January.

Mills insisted that despite what anything thinks their agents will be holding talks with clubs in the Premier League as well behind the curtains.

He stressed that if the trio do not sign new deals before January there is a real chance that their heads will be somewhere else in the second half of the season.

The former Premier League star stressed that three key players focusing on things beyond their on-the-pitch performances could derail Liverpool’s campaign.

“What’s going to become a concern is in two months’ time Trent, Van Dijk and Mo Salah can talk to foreign clubs, and their agents will be talking to Premier League clubs”, Mills said on talkSPORT.

“We both know that’s going to happen.

“At that point if they are not going to stay at Liverpool and if they are not going to sign, do their heads turn slightly?

“Do performances start to dip a little bit? We saw what happened after Jurgen Klopp announced his retirement, they struggled.

“It’s tough to do that and all of a sudden those three key players might be thinking my future is elsewhere, I want to be fit for where you go next and am I going to push myself in training and games?

“I don’t know the answer as I don’t know them personally but that would be my worry.”
